Position Overview
The Quality Control (QC) Analyst plays a crucial role in ensuring the integrity and reliability of laboratory operations. This position involves conducting internal assessments, supporting external evaluations, and managing the upkeep of quality control documentation, certifications, and the review and modification of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).

Key Responsibilities
The responsibilities of the QC Analyst may encompass the following:

  • Facilitate team meetings to discuss quality standards and improvements.
  • Conduct thorough data audits to ensure compliance with established protocols.
  • Perform audits in response to client inquiries and regulatory requirements.
  • Assist in the preparation and response to external audits from clients and regulatory bodies.
  • Review Quality Assurance Project Plans, along with technical and quality control specifications in contracts and proposals.
  • Support the maintenance of laboratory certifications and accreditations.
  • Coordinate the scheduling, ordering, logging, and reporting of proficiency testing samples.
  • Stay informed about new regulations and effectively communicate updates to laboratory personnel.
  • Draft and revise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) as necessary.
  • Maintain comprehensive historical records of technical documentation, including SOPs and quality control data.
  • Assist in monitoring the laboratory's adherence to reference methods, SOPs, and specific agency requirements.
  • Keep training records updated, including Demonstrations of Capability (DOCs) for all laboratory analysts.
  • Identify systematic issues within the laboratory and propose solutions for ongoing or recurring nonconformance.
  • Track and analyze customer feedback to identify areas for improvement.
  • Oversee and evaluate Method Detection Limit (MDL) studies.
  • Generate control charts and control limits, ensuring updates to the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S).
  • Coordinate or conduct calibration of laboratory support equipment.
